Advantages of Planetary Gearboxes in Power Generation Systems
- High Power Density: Planetary gearboxes offer a high power-to-weight ratio, making them ideal for compact power generation systems.
- Efficient Power Transmission: The design of planetary gearboxes allows for efficient power transmission, minimizing energy losses.
- Multiple Speed Ratios: Planetary gearboxes can provide multiple speed ratios, allowing for flexible power generation operations.
- Excellent Load Distribution: The arrangement of multiple gears in a planetary system ensures uniform load distribution, enhancing the gearbox’s durability and reliability.
- Quiet and Smooth Operation: Planetary gearboxes are known for their quiet and smooth operation, reducing noise pollution in power generation systems.
Working Principle of Planetary Gearboxes
Planetary gearboxes consist of a central sun gear, multiple planet gears, and an outer ring gear. The sun gear is located at the center and transfers power to the planet gears, which are connected to the outer ring gear. As the sun gear rotates, the planet gears revolve around it, resulting in the desired gear ratio.
Choosing the Right Planetary Gearboxes for Power Generation Systems
- Load Capacity: Consider the torque and power requirements of your power generation system to select a planetary gearbox with the appropriate load capacity.
- Input and Output Speed Requirements: Determine the desired input and output speed ranges to choose a gearbox that can meet the operational needs of your power generation system.
- Efficiency: Look for gearboxes with high efficiency ratings to minimize energy losses during power transmission.
- Size and Compactness: Consider the available space and weight restrictions to select a compact and lightweight planetary gearbox that can fit within your power generation system.
- Reliability and Durability: Choose gearboxes from reputable manufacturers known for their high-quality products that can withstand the demanding operating conditions of power generation systems.
